  • Full-Cycle Ground-Up Construction Management Direct comprehensive oversight of ground-up construction projects across all phases:
    • Due Diligence & Land Acquisition: Evaluate site feasibility during transaction phases assessing physical environmental regulatory and financial factors.
    • Feasibility Studies: Lead technical and financial analysis to determine project scope budget parameters schedule requirements and risk factors.
    • Design Development: Coordinate with architects engineers and consultants to develop construction documents that meet project objectives and budget requirements.
    • Planning & Zoning Review: Manage municipal approval processes coordinate with regulatory authorities and ensure compliance with applicable requirements.
    • Pre-Construction: Direct contractor selection subcontractor procurement value engineering constructability reviews and project mobilization.
    • Construction Phase: Oversee construction operations including schedule management quality control budget tracking change order processing and safety compliance.
    • Closeout: Manage project closeout including punch lists inspections commissioning warranty documentation and client handover.
